Level 2 Significant Drought Declared💧

The Town of Dover is currently experiencing a Level 2 Significant Drought. For residents and businesses in Dover, this limits nonessential outdoor water use.

The Dover Board of Selectmen declared a Level 2 Significant Drought on June 8, 2026, and voted to limit nonessential outdoor water use to hand-held hoses or watering cans only, specifically after 5:00 PM and before 9:00 AM.

Dover’s Water Restriction Bylaw, adopted in 2022, applies to all water sources, including Aquarion, municipal water, and private wells. Learn more in Ch. 182 Water Use Restrictions in Dover’s local bylaws.

The Town of Dover's Department of Public Works has been awarded a pair of grants, totaling $521,245, under the Massachusetts Department of Transportation's (MassDOT) Community Culvert Grant Program! These funds will be used to replace the Wilsondale Street culvert, as well as the Old Farm Road culvert.

After years of planning and multiple grant submissions, this funding allows the DPW to modernize aging infrastructure, improve stormwater management, and reduce flooding risks without impacting local property taxes!

Thank you to the Katelyn Tosi Foundation for their generous donation to the Dover Fire Department! This contribution will enhance fire and medical services in Dover while honoring Katelyn Tosi's legacy.

The Dover Fire Department is honored and deeply grateful to receive the first annual $40,000 donation from the Katelyn Tosi Foundation in memory of Katelyn Tosi.

This generous gift will support the Department's ongoing mission of providing exceptional fire and emergency medical services to Dover residents while honoring Katelyn's legacy and the values of service, compassion, and community that she embodied.

The Tosi family's connection to the Dover Fire Department spans generations. Katelyn's mother, Renee Foster, dedicated more than 30 years of service to the Department, retiring as a Lieutenant and EMS Coordinator. Today, her father, Captain Bobby Tosi, along with her brothers, Lieutenant Kevin Tosi and Lieutenant Brian Tosi, continue that tradition of service as members of the Dover Fire Department.
